The emotions playing out in her face screamed:
I’m going to kill you for this
! And I thought, okay, if I was going to die anyway, we would at least have some fun before. It was her turn to sing, and I held the microphone in front of her kissable mouth.

Her nails dug into my stomach where she clamped my shirt, and I could feel her heart hammering in her chest where she pressed against me. “Sing,” I mouthed and gave her the most encouraging look manageable.

Liza grimaced and squeezed her eyes shut. But she opened her mouth and within a few seconds her panicky croak turned into a really beautiful singing voice. Her eyes opened again, and she looked at me with wonder, like she was totally amazed about herself and how well she did. Heck, she even smiled as we sang together. Soon her clawed fingers uncurled, and she pressed her palm against my chest. I placed my hand on top of hers, trying to give her the safe feeling she needed.

When
the crowd started singing with us, her face lit up even more. I got the feeling she really enjoyed herself and figured we could do a little more than just stand poker stiff. Slipping behind her, I took her hands and lifted them over her head. Together we clapped to the beat, and our audience mirrored us. I stood very close to her, enjoying the nearness, and sang in her ear while she had the mike all to herself. She delivered an amazing show. That was my girl. Vulnerable like a kitten, but strong and brave when she needed to be.

The song’s end was drowned out by the clubbers’
whistles and shouts, prompting us to perform another song. I was totally up to it, but this time I thought it better to ask Liza first. “What do you think?”

“I think I’m going to kill you.”

Yeah, I knew that and laughed.

“No way are we doing this again.”
She grabbed my hand like I’d done with her before and made me follow her down from the stage.

I shrugged and grinned at the expectant crowed as I was dragged away.

When we reached the bar again, Rachel had switched sides and stood with Phil behind the counter now. “That was awesome!” She beamed at Liza and me together. “You’d really make a sweet couple.”

Liza laughed about that.
“Yeah, right.”

Yeah, right
? Did that mean no? I gave her a wry look and she cast me the same look back, then she stuck her tongue out at me and laughed again.

Okay, Hunter, make something of that
, I thought.

A little later, she asked me if it was okay to leave. It was almost midnight, and I remembered that I’d promised to take Cinderella back before one. I let Rachel kiss my cheek as we told them goodbye, and she whispered into my ear that she’d come home tomorrow and intended to get all the details about me and Liza.

“All right,” I surrendered. “But only if you bring cherry cake.” She made the best cake in all California, I swear.

Out in the cool air, I took a few deep breaths, getting rid of the dry smoke in my lungs,
then I turned to Liza who pressed her palms to her red cheeks. “Want to drive again?”

She shook her head
. “The way I feel right now I might very well wrap your car around a tree.”

Still shaky from the excitement, eh?
I put my arm around her shoulders like we already were a real couple. She didn’t back away. And when her shy hand moved up to rest on my hip, my stomach did a double roll of joy.

Opening the passenger door for her, I let her get in first,
then I walked around and made myself comfortable in the driver’s seat, adjusting it to my longer legs.

Since Liza was looking out the side window, I figured she wasn’t up for talking, so I switched the radio on but kept the volume low. I liked how her beautiful scent filled the interior and my head. It was hard to concentrate on driving, when my thoughts drifted to my right time and again, and I remembered how her tender lips had felt beneath mine.

After a few minutes, she turned her head toward me and studied me instead of the passing streetlamps.

I cut a quick glance toward her
. “Did you enjoy yourself tonight?” It was nice to speak in a softer tone again after shouting so much inside the club.

Liza gazed at me for a couple of seconds longer before she answered,
“It was okay.” Then after a short pause she added, “Actually, it was quite nice.”

As I cut another glance at her, she made a point at playfully narrowing her eyes at me. “
But I still hate you!”

That coaxed a chuckle from me. “I know.” And I didn’t mind as long as she stayed in this car with me. “
I’m sorry I dragged you into hell on that stage.”

“And you
should
be.”

A car passed us, and the headlights made me squint for a moment. But when the car had disappeared also from the review mirror,
I moved most of my attention away from the silent road and back to Liza. “What about the lime surprise?”

“What about it?”

“Should I be sorry about that, too?”

Liza let me wait on her answer for a couple of seconds.
I was holding my breath in that time. Then she said in a nonchalant, “Nah. I should just have heeded your warning.”

“Yeah.
Or maybe…just not.” Because as far as I was concerned, it had been one helluva hot kiss, and I didn’t want to have missed it.

With a lower voice than before, Liza drawled,
“Or maybe not…”

Heck, did she just agree?
“You liked it?” I cut a quick glance to her side and noticed the blush on her cheeks. That made me smile. “Yeah, you did.”

Liza didn’t say more to it, but after one last, shy look at me, she tilted her head the other way and continued gazing out the window. In the reflection of the glass, I glimpsed her pleased face.

We arrived at her house way too soon.

“Can you park a bit farther up this road?” Liza asked me then. “I don’t want my parents to find out I was gone missing.”

Sunshine, they already know.
But I did as she said, and as we got out of the car, I shut my door quickly to keep as much of her nice scent as possible saved inside for the ride home.

I walked her back into her garden in a casual stroll. I liked watching her as we went. Everything about her was perfect. The only thing wrong was that she wasn’t tucked under my arm right now. It was definitely worth a try, but Liza turned her head to my side at that moment, and when her lips curved up, I knew I was caught staring. For a change this made me feel awkward.
Somehow exposed. With a sheepish grin, I rubbed my neck, looking away.

In front of the little shed in her garden, I took a stance with my back to the door and waited for her to put her foot into my laced hands to help her up. She grabbed my shoulders and stepped in, but before I lifted her, I took a second to look into her apple eyes.
“What do you say, Matthews? Shall we do this again sometime?”

Liza glanced up to her room and back at me.
“Maybe we should. But let’s wait until my detention is over. I really hate sneaking in and out like a criminal.”

I could live with that.

With a strong push, I hoisted her onto the roof and waited until she’d made it to her feet. Sneaking back into her room, she whispered, “Good night.”

“Later ’gator,” I said back.

Heading back to my car, I could have slapped myself for missing the opportunity to steal a goodnight kiss before I’d shot her up on that roof. By now I was pretty confident she wouldn’t have slapped me for it. Damn, what if she’d even expected it and I just screwed that chance.

I climbed into the car and banged my head on the steering wheel. I was such an idiot. Maybe I should send her a goodnight text at least. Just to tell her that I really loved spending this evening with her. And maybe making plans to see her again tomorrow?

Shifting in the seat, I fished in my pocket for my phone then I stared at the screen. Suddenly I had a better idea. Way better…

Chapter 11

 

THE WARM NIGHT coated my neck with a layer of moist as I jogged back to Liza’s house. Underneath her window, I lifted my Indian’s cap, raked a hand through my hair, and put the cap on again. This was my chance at Liza, and I wasn’t going to ruin it. Not after waiting half my high school years on it.

The light in her room was already off. I could call her to the window now then talk her outside again. Or I could give a damn about being a gentleman and behave like a man my age. Turning around, I took a short run toward the tree, jumped, and hoisted myself onto the thickest branch. From there it was only a large step onto the shed’s roof. I didn’t hesitate a second but strode directly at Liza’s room and ducked through the window.

At that moment the light went on, and a sharp voice said, “Hunter. What are
you
doing here?”

I looked up and found Liza standing barefoot and in that amazing, hot boy shorts, just a couple of feet away from me. “I forgot something.”

She quirked her brows like she questioned my sanity. “You can’t just come up here. I’m already in my jammies.”

Hell yeah, that was one of the reason why it had to be
now
and not any other time. “I’ve never seen anything sexier than those shorts on you.” Seizing every inch of her skin with my gaze, I prowled toward her. The longer I looked at her legs, the more of a goose bump dusting she got.

Liza took a step back for each I took toward her. She wouldn’t escape. Finally she was stopped by her bed and I had still one foot of distance to overcome. But I stopped when she did, and hooked my finger into the waistband of her mouthwatering shorts instead. Pulling her toward me, I locked gazes with her. Liza’s eyes were wide and shiny. Her mouth hung slightly open as she moved her hands up and placed them flat on my chest. My pecs twitched in response to this intimate touch, and I was all set for ripping my shirt open, so I could feel her warm hands on my skin.

Liza’s breathing hitched noticeably. “You forgot something?” It was a shy croak. “What?”

Seriously, we had talked enough tonight. Now was the time of satisfying a deep need within me. I pulled my Indian’s cap off and tossed it on the bed, never breaking eye contact with her. With one arm around her delicate waist, I pulled her into me and thrust my other hand into her silky hair.

Liza’s breath came fast against my skin. My gaze dropped from her eyes to her lush lips. I knew I was going to die, if I couldn’t sample them again this minute. Slowly, I leaned down and rendered her mine.

Pressing a feather-light kiss on her lips, I waited to see if she kept breathing this time. Oh yes, she did.
And more. Her soft, little hands moved up and around my neck, her fingers threading through my hair. It made me go crazy and wild about her. Growling, I pulled her tighter against me and invaded her sweet mouth with my tongue. The Coke and lime taste was gone, replaced by the taste of minty toothpaste.

In slow strokes, I started playing with her tongue. Liza shivered in my arms. She rose on her toes to match my height just a little more, rubbing her boobs in a dangerously seductive way against my chest. If there really could be butterflies in one’s stomach, there was
definitively one playing havoc in mine now.

She didn’t like it when I broke the kiss, but I inched back anyway then leaned my brow against hers, getting a grip on myself or I’d toss her onto that bed and make love to her.
As I gazed into her bottomless green eyes, I remembered the diary again, and thought I could make up for it by giving her a little truth about me, too. Something she might like to know.

“By the way,
” I said softly. “I’ve known your name since the very day that you first came to watch Mitchell’s soccer training in third grade, Liza.”

A smile tugged hard on the corners of her lips, but apparently she didn’t want to let it come.
Instead she teased, “Have you, really?”

If she wasn’t going to smile, then I wasn’t either, so I pressed my lips together, but I knew it wouldn’t work
. I nudged her nose with the tip of mine. “Um-hm.”

The next instant, I found my lips on hers once more. A low moan escaped her, which I cupped with my mouth, and it took me to the edge of self-control.
To hell with
gentle
. Raking back her hair, I tilted her face farther up and ravished her mouth with a deep, ferocious kiss.

She stood only at the beginning of learning, but she was quick and took up with the lust I breathed. In sensual moves, her tongue brushed against mine. She suckled and nipped my bottom lip, groaning when I did the same to her. Gone wild with longing, I stroked down her neck and spine, finding an easy way underneath her tank
top, and explored every little bit of her.

All the shyness abandoned, Liza utterly melted into my embrace. I placed my hands on her bottom, ready to lift her up so she would wrap her naked legs around my hips. But a hard pull at my collar made me stumble backward, and Liza slipped away from me.

It was the shock in her eyes that made me realize who had come even before I heard the sharp bellow behind me.
